USGS 04066500 PIKE RIVER AT AMBERG, WI

PROVISIONAL DATA SUBJECT TO REVISION

Click to hidestation-specific text

LOCATION.--Lat 45°30'00", long 88°00'00", in SE 1/4 SE 1/4 sec.16, T.35 N., R.20 E., Marinette County, Hydrologic Unit 04030108, on right bank 35 feet upstream from bridge on County Trunk Highway V, 0.4 mile southwest of Amberg.

DRAINAGE AREA.--255 square miles.

PERIOD OF RECORD.--February 1914 to September 1970, June 2000 to present.

GAGE.--Water-stage recorder. Elevation of gage, 853.56 ft. NAVD88 from GPS survey. Prior to June 2000 located at a site downstream at a different datum. See WSP 1727 for history of changes prior to Oct. 7, 1946.

REMARKS.--Gage-height telemeter at station.
